Output 12f295e8314bc9335a952f512963d142c530790e4eaf7bf4c7fcfa18644f4c75:0

value
30995293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 963a9a08ada097147e46637fdeb46e0ee5c61f43 OP_EQUAL
address
MMbVnvRWcuPtryNuxEnzkcV2vJQFwZMLha
transaction
12f295e8314bc9335a952f512963d142c530790e4eaf7bf4c7fcfa18644f4c75
spent
true